A GUIDE FOR DOMESTIC HELPERS: BUILDING TRUST AND SUCCESS IN YOUR ROLE
Being a domestic helper is more than just a job—it is about becoming a trusted and valued part of a family. Every day includes responsibilities like child care, cooking, cleaning, and managing household tasks. To succeed as a domestic helper, a positive attitude, patience, and strong communication skills are essential.
Understanding employer expectations is the key to building trust. Always listen carefully, follow instructions, and ask questions if something is unclear. Clear communication helps avoid misunderstandings and creates a smooth working relationship between you and your employer.
Good time management improves your daily efficiency. Organize your schedule by prioritizing important tasks such as child care and household chores. Creating a routine helps you stay focused, reduce stress, and complete your work effectively.
Trust, honesty, and respect are the foundation of long-term success. Being reliable, polite, and responsible will make employers feel comfortable and confident in your work. Taking initiative and showing willingness to learn new skills will also help you stand out as a professional domestic helper.
Taking care of yourself is just as important as taking care of others. Use your rest day to relax, recharge, and stay connected with your family and friends. A healthy mindset and good well-being allow you to perform your duties better.
